Tour games - Blame the players

The current itinerary with the lack of tour or should we call them 'practice matches' has been a matter of heated debate. Since the BCCI is the favourite whipping boy, everyone has vented their spleen on them for reducing them to nothing.

 

However when you take a look at these statistics; they start right from our 1947-48 tour to the 2003-04 tour, you are left wondering whether the BCCI should be blamed.

 

                              Played  Won  Lost  Drawn

 

Total:                       31         8       11      12

 

It is obvious that our cricketers have reduced these games to an extended net practice and have consistently failed to use these matches to establish an early dominance over their opponents.

 

Recognizing the fact that our players consider these matches to be a chore the BCCI has fallen in step with their wish and reduced the number of these 'charades'.

 

So why blame the BCCI when the fault lies with our players?
